HFIR Operations Engineer

Matt has been working with ORNL since 2009.  He began his career as a Nuclear Reactor Controller at the High Flux Isotope Reactor (HFIR) where he ultimately qualified as a Senior Reactor Operator.  In July of 2021, he transitioned to the Nuclear Safety & Experiment Analysis Group to work as a Nuclear Safety Analyst.  As a safety analyst, he ensured any procedural or physical changes to the HFIR systems are bounded by the existing safety documents or are approved by DOE.  As a Nuclear Safety Analyst, he was also responsible for coordinating the Safety Related Equipment List and was a member of the Safety Analysis Report for Packaging (SARP) team supporting fresh fuel packaging recertification by the NRC.  In December of 2023, Matt transitioned back into HFIR operations as an Operations Engineer which supports the daily activities of the HFIR operations group including managing shipments of fissile materials.  He received a BS in Nuclear Engineering Technology from Thomas Edison State College in 2008 and a MS in Engineering Management from Penn State in 2016.  He brings prior professional experience as an 8 year veteran of the US Navy as a submarine nuclear reactor operator and electronics technician.
